[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Commit-gnuradio] r6630 - gnuradio/trunk/debian
From: |
jcorgan |
Subject: |
[Commit-gnuradio] r6630 - gnuradio/trunk/debian |
Date: |
Sat, 13 Oct 2007 14:50:09 -0600 (MDT) |
Author: jcorgan
Date: 2007-10-13 14:50:09 -0600 (Sat, 13 Oct 2007)
New Revision: 6630
Added:
gnuradio/trunk/debian/libusrp0c2a.postinst
gnuradio/trunk/debian/libusrp0c2a.postrm
gnuradio/trunk/debian/libusrp0c2a.udev
Modified:
gnuradio/trunk/debian/libusrp0c2a.dirs
gnuradio/trunk/debian/libusrp0c2a.install
gnuradio/trunk/debian/rules
Log:
Added enabling group 'user' access to USRP hardware into Debian packaging.
Modified: gnuradio/trunk/debian/libusrp0c2a.dirs
===================================================================
--- gnuradio/trunk/debian/libusrp0c2a.dirs 2007-10-13 12:56:49 UTC (rev
6629)
+++ gnuradio/trunk/debian/libusrp0c2a.dirs 2007-10-13 20:50:09 UTC (rev
6630)
@@ -1,3 +1,3 @@
usr/lib
usr/lib/pkgconfig
-etc/hotplug.d/usb
+etc/udev/rules.d
Modified: gnuradio/trunk/debian/libusrp0c2a.install
===================================================================
--- gnuradio/trunk/debian/libusrp0c2a.install 2007-10-13 12:56:49 UTC (rev
6629)
+++ gnuradio/trunk/debian/libusrp0c2a.install 2007-10-13 20:50:09 UTC (rev
6630)
@@ -1,3 +1,4 @@
-usr/lib/pkgconfig/usrp.pc
usr/lib/libusrp.la
usr/lib/libusrp.so.*
+usr/lib/pkgconfig/usrp.pc
+etc/udev/rules.d/40-usrp.rules
Added: gnuradio/trunk/debian/libusrp0c2a.postinst
===================================================================
--- gnuradio/trunk/debian/libusrp0c2a.postinst (rev 0)
+++ gnuradio/trunk/debian/libusrp0c2a.postinst 2007-10-13 20:50:09 UTC (rev
6630)
@@ -0,0 +1,14 @@
+#! /bin/sh
+
+set -e
+
+if [ "$1" != "configure" ]; then
+ exit 0
+fi
+
+# Create usrp group for udev access
+if ! getent group usrp >/dev/null; then
+ addgroup --system usrp
+fi
+
+exit 0
Added: gnuradio/trunk/debian/libusrp0c2a.postrm
===================================================================
--- gnuradio/trunk/debian/libusrp0c2a.postrm (rev 0)
+++ gnuradio/trunk/debian/libusrp0c2a.postrm 2007-10-13 20:50:09 UTC (rev
6630)
@@ -0,0 +1,11 @@
+#! /bin/sh
+
+set -e
+
+if [ "$1" != "remove" ]; then
+ exit 0
+fi
+
+rm -f /etc/udev/rules.d/40-usrp.rules
+
+exit 0
Added: gnuradio/trunk/debian/libusrp0c2a.udev
===================================================================
--- gnuradio/trunk/debian/libusrp0c2a.udev (rev 0)
+++ gnuradio/trunk/debian/libusrp0c2a.udev 2007-10-13 20:50:09 UTC (rev
6630)
@@ -0,0 +1 @@
+ACTION=="add", BUS=="usb", SYSFS{idVendor}=="fffe", SYSFS{idProduct}=="0002",
GROUP:="usrp", MODE:="0660"
Modified: gnuradio/trunk/debian/rules
===================================================================
--- gnuradio/trunk/debian/rules 2007-10-13 12:56:49 UTC (rev 6629)
+++ gnuradio/trunk/debian/rules 2007-10-13 20:50:09 UTC (rev 6630)
@@ -80,12 +80,11 @@
fi; \
done
- dh_install --sourcedir=debian/tmp
+ : # Deposit rule to allow group 'usrp' access to USRP hardware
+ install -m 0755 -D debian/libusrp0c2a.udev \
+ debian/tmp/etc/udev/rules.d/40-usrp.rules
-# FIXME: Ubuntu vs. Debian (below)
-# install -m 0755 debian/usrp.hotplug \
-# $(CURDIR)/debian/usrp/etc/hotplug.d/usb/
-
+ dh_install --sourcedir=debian/tmp
touch $@
[Prev in Thread] |
Current Thread |
[Next in Thread] |
- [Commit-gnuradio] r6630 - gnuradio/trunk/debian,
jcorgan <=